Frequently asked questions
How much do Customer Service employees make?

Employees as Customer Service earn an average of ₹16.0lakhs, mostly ranging from ₹10.1lakhs per year to ₹50.6lakhs per year based on 1076 profiles. The top 10% of employees earn more than ₹30.8lakhs per year.

What is the average salary of Customer Service?

Average salary of an employee as Customer Service is ₹16.0lakhs.

What is the highest salary offered as Customer Service?

Highest reported salary offered as Customer Service is ₹117.4lakhs. The top 10% of employees earn more than ₹30.8lakhs per year. The top 1% earn more than a whopping ₹50.6lakhs per year.

What are the most common skills required as Customer Service?

14% of employees have skills in customer service . 7% also know operations management . 5% also know project management .

What are the highest paying jobs as Customer Service?

The top 5 highest paying jobs as Customer Service with reported salaries are:

  • director - ₹44.0lakhs per year

  • vice president - ₹44.0lakhs per year

  • national head - ₹37.0lakhs per year

  • senior customer service officer - ₹36.0lakhs per year

  • zonal head - ₹36.0lakhs per year

What are the fresher salaries as Customer Service?
  • customer service - ₹4.0lakhs per year

  • customer service executive - ₹5.0lakhs per year

What is the median salary offered as Customer Service?

The median salary approximately calculated from salary profiles measured so far is ₹13.8lakhs per year.

How is the age distributed among employees as Customer Service?

21% of employees lie between 36-41 yrs . 18% of the employees fall in the age group of 31-36 yrs .

What qualifications do employees have as Customer Service?

30% hold a PostGraduate degree. 19% hold a Graduate degree.

Which schools do employees working as Customer Service went to?

8% of employees studied at Mumbai University . 4% studied at Delhi University - Other .
